Is Philadelphia's Temple University a secular school?

It is. There is no mention of a religious affiliation on the Temple University website or in its mission statement. According to many college websites such as collegeprowler.com and the Princeton Review, Temple is a secular school. It does have many clubs and organizations for students and staff interested in specific religions.
